Now into its second year, this 10 mile walk is a way to challenge yourself, friends and family and help raise funds to protect wildlife. Along this scenic yet challenging walk you will discover the River Chess, walk through our stunning Frogmore Meadows Nature Reserve and immerse yourself in the beautiful wildlife you are helping to protect. The walk is well signposted and it will be easy to maintain social distancing at all times.
Working throughout Herts and Middlesex we take practical action every day to protect wildlife and to connect people with nature.
With the support of people like you, we care for over 40 nature reserves from woodlands to globally rare chalk streams - all to benefit wildlife and our local communities.
We believe everyone has the right to benefit from access to nature. With free access to our nature reserves and many events every year, we provide the opportunity for people of all backgrounds to learn about and get closer to the wildlife on their doorsteps.
